✦ Synopsis
Abstract
A spurious suppression method by using the “T” feeders is proposed and investigated. A novel band pass filter using “T” feeders is implemented. The measured results of the filter demonstrate good spurious suppression. The experimental results of the filter operating at the center frequency f~0~ = 1.87 GHz are the fractional bandwidth of 9%, the insertion loss of 1.7 dB, the return loss better than 25 dB. The spurious frequency with rejection larger than 25 dB is up to 5f~0~. Below 1 GHz, the stop‐band rejection is larger than 51.5 dB, and the largest stop‐band rejection is 54 dB in the upper stop‐band. © 2009 Wiley Periodicals, Inc.
